              The Full Screen issue can be resolved by doing the following:

              Go to System Preferences > Mission Control > You need to turn _“Displays have separate Spaces”_ **OFF** and then restart machine.
              Isadora stages will then go full screen as normal.

                                      Had the problem with G-Force via Syphoner to Izzy. Stage image stopped and I had always to click on Syphoner. So I deactivated Nap Mode- click on Information in the app and tick deactivate nap mode- Now it works without stopping.

                                        I am running a USB3 DisplayLink adaptor to HDMI over CAT6 (MBP non-retina, Thunderbolt terminated by Blackmagic 3D). Have been running "Uncles & Angels" show for more than a year on this without problems... tried out Mavericks today and the DisplayLink does... terrible things... (should have checked their website, it's all spelled out there!).

                                        Solution: will be creating a Mountain Lion partition to just run Izzy and the few other bits needed for the show... which is a good idea in any case as the system will be super clean when performing. 
                                        Hope it works, will update if any issues
                                        and yes the update to Mavericks was rash at best!

                                            Update: DisplayLink drivers working perfectly on clean installed 60 GB Mountain Lion partition, with Izzy and essential drivers the only added apps (external TB RAID for video). Boot to Mavericks for day to day business, reboot to squeaky-clean ML for performances... works like a charm! Doing Uncles & Angels in St Nazaire and Nantes this coming week, so was playing with fire actually... but really like having a kind of alter-ego stripped down machine now just for Izzy.
